Andmeteadlik vastavuse kontrollimine



Journal Title

Journal ISSN

Volume Title



Vastavuse kontrollimine on üks kõige tavalisemaid ülesandeid protsessikaeve valdkonnas. Vastavuse kontrollimise peamine eesmärk on kontrollida protsessimudeli vastavust sündmuste logidele selleks, et hinnata või kirjeldada kuidas registreeritud käitumine protsessimudelis kirjeldatud käitumisest erineb. Enamus olemasolevatest vastavuse kontrollimise tehnikaid põhineb kontrollvoolu perspektiivile. Käesolev lõputöö pakub välja tehnika, mis lisaks kontrollvoolule põhinevale tehnikale arvestab ka andmete perspektiivile. Väljapakutud lähenemisviis on implementeeritud tarkvaralise lahendusena, mis kasutab sisendiks BPMN mudelit ja sündmuste logi. Loodud tarkvara töörist on loodud kasutades programmeerimiskeelt Elixir. Lõputöö sisaldab samuti ka välja töötatud lahenduse tulemuslikkuse hinnangut.
Conformance checking is one of the most common tasks in the field process mining. The goal of conformance checking is to compare a process model against an event log in order to quantify or describe how the behavior recorded in the log deviates with respect to the behavior captured by the process model. Most of the existing conformance checking techniques focus on the control-flow perspective. In this thesis, we propose a conformance checking technique that takes into account the data perspectives in addition to the control-flow perspective. The proposed approach is implemented as a tool that takes as input a BPMN process model and an event log. The tool has been implemented using the Elixir programming language. The thesis also reports on a performance evaluation of the proposed approach.


